Neutrogena Ultra Gentle Lotion Review

Living in a dry, cold climate like Boston is harsh on anyone’s skin; but on my naturally dry skin it’s wicked brutal! Not only does my skin flake, I get red patches when the climate goes negative. It’s not pretty and very uncomfortable. I’m always wary of trying products that cater specifically to dry skin. I usually end up breaking out because the product is so oily.

I need my skin to drink up the moisture, not let it sit on the surface. When two lovely products arrived from Neutrogena I didn’t hesitate at all. Neutrogena is famous for a good reason. Their new Ultra Gentle Soothing Line  is clinically proven to instantly soothe even the most sensitive skin. It’s lightweight and oil-free to use daily, plus reduces redness with its chamomile blend.

I like to use the lotion in the morning for a lighter treatment and the spf15 protection. Even in winter, spf is so important!

At night I use the Ultra Gentle Soothing Cream. The cream is thicker than the lotion and helps keep my skin hydrated throughout the night.

Here are some quick facts about Neutrogena Ultra Gentle Soothing Cream:

Light, soothing cream formulated with a soothing chamomile blend to instantly hydrate and calm sensitive skin

Clinically proven to:

    • Make sensitive skin less sensitive
    • Visibly reduce redness
    • Strengthen skin’s moisture barrier
    • Make skin less sensitive over time
    • Contains gentle hypoallergenic fragrance uniquely developed for sensitive skin
    • Oil-free and allergy tested

..and Neutrogena Ultra Gentle Soothing Lotion:

Daily lotion formulated with a soothing chamomile blend to instantly hydrate and calm sensitive skin while providing  broad spectrum UVA/UVB protection

Clinically proven to:

    • Make sensitive skin less sensitive
    • Provide broad spectrum SPF 15 UVA/UVB protection
    • Visibly reduce redness
    • Strengthen skin’s moisture barrier
    • Contains gentle hypoallergenic fragrance uniquely developed for sensitive skin
    • Oil-free and allergy tested

These are definitely winter creams you want handy even if you don’t have dry skin. They don’t have intense perfumes or an oily residue, just clean, soothing relief!
